Understanding the Complementary Angles Calculator

The Complementary Angles Calculator is a tool designed to help you quickly find the complementary angle when one angle is provided. Complementary angles are two angles whose measures add up to 90 degrees. This concept is fundamental in geometry and trigonometry, playing a crucial role in various mathematical problems and real-world applications.

How the Complementary Angles Calculator Works

The calculator operates on a simple principle. If you have one angle, let’s call it Angle A, you can find its complementary angle, Angle B, by subtracting Angle A from 90 degrees. The formula is:

“The complementary angle of Angle A is 90 degrees minus Angle A.”

For example, if Angle A is 30 degrees, the complementary angle (Angle B) will be:

“Angle B = 90 degrees – 30 degrees = 60 degrees.”

FAQ

Question 1: What are complementary angles?

Complementary angles are two angles whose measures add up to 90 degrees. For example, if one angle measures 40 degrees, the other would measure 50 degrees to make a total of 90 degrees.

Question 4: Why are complementary angles important in geometry?

Complementary angles are crucial in geometry because they often appear in right triangles and other geometric shapes. Understanding these angles helps in solving various problems related to angle measures and properties of shapes.

Question 5: Are complementary angles always acute?

Yes, complementary angles are always acute because their measures add up to 90 degrees. Both angles must be less than 90 degrees individually.
